About this spot

Fishing Horse Reach

Horse Reach is a channel in Charleston Harbor, South Carolina. Depth is 15-60 ft, with a slope. Its profile reads channel, inner water and semi-exposed.

Waterlands scores 24 species here; the best right now are red drum, Atlantic tarpon and crevalle jack. It is peak season now for red drum, Atlantic tarpon, crevalle jack and gray snapper, and shoulder season for weakfish, Spanish mackerel, black drum and black sea bass. Red drum peak from August through November. Atlantic tarpon peak from July through September. Crevalle jack peak from July through October.

Tackle & technique

Sheepshead
Sheepshead graze barnacles and crabs off pilings, jetty rocks, bridge supports, oyster bars and nearshore reefs, from a few feet deep out to about 50 feet. Drop a fiddler crab, sand flea or piece of shrimp on a small, strong hook straight down next to the structure with just enough weight to hold bottom. The bite is a light tap, so keep the line tight and set the hook fast.
Red drum
Redfish feed on shallow grass flats, oyster bars and marsh edges, often in 1 to 4 feet of water, and drop into channels, deep holes and tidal creeks when the water turns very hot or cold. Work a live shrimp under a popping cork or a soft plastic along the grass line on a rising tide, then fish creek mouths and drains as the tide falls. Bull reds over 30 inches school in the surf, passes and jetties in late summer and fall, where cut mullet or a live crab on the bottom is the standard approach.
Atlantic tarpon
Tarpon roll along beaches, in passes and channels, and under bridges from late spring through fall, and in South Florida some fish stay through winter in warm canals and backcountry rivers. Live crabs, mullet or pinfish drifted through a pass on the outgoing tide, or a fly or soft plastic cast ahead of a rolling string of fish, are the main approaches. Use a long heavy leader, bow to the jumps, and keep big fish in the water for release.
